Student Population by Gender

White Mountains Community College has a total of 523 enrolled students for the academic year 2022-2023. All 523 students are enrolled into undergraduate programs.
By gender, 186 male and 337 female students (the male-female ratio is 36:64) are attending the school. The gender distribution is based on the 2022-2023 data.

Student Distribution by Race/Ethnicity

By race/ethnicity, 402 White, 7 Black, and 8 Asian students out of a total of 523 are attending at White Mountains Community College. Comprehensive enrollment statistic data by race/ethnicity is shown in the next chart (Academic year 2022-2023 data).

Online Student Enrollment

Distance learning, also called online education, is very attractive to students, especially who want to continue education and work in field. At White Mountains Community College, 120 students are enrolled exclusively in online courses and 146 students are enrolled in some online courses.
105 students lived in New Hampshire or jurisdiction in which the school is located are enrolled exclusively in online courses and 15 students live in other State or outside of the United States.

Transfer-in Students (Undergraduate)

Among 523 enrolled in undergraduate programs, 49 students have transferred-in from other institutions. The percentage of transfer-in students is 9.37%.22 students have transferred in as full-time status and 27 students transferred in as part-time status.
